What is Chaska Machine & Tool?
Chaska Machine & Tool is a long-standing provider of high-quality short-run and medium-run metal stampings, serving the Twin Cities area for over five decades. The company emphasizes total customer satisfaction through rapid service and in-house precision tooling. Additional capabilities include laser cutting and value-added solutions, all offered at competitive price points. Chaska Machine & Tool's dedication to quality and safety is further validated by its ISO 9000 compliance, positioning it as a reliable partner in precision manufacturing.
